Virtualmin is an extension of Webmin, which is a very popular system admin interface for Linux systems. It’s also one of the few free and open-source options on this list, although paid plans are also available in case you need more features.

You’re also able to extend Virtualmin using several applications and scripts for around 100 different products. That said, integration with the cloud is already included out of the box so that you can set up cloud storage with Amazon S3, Dropbox, Google Cloud, Rackspace, and more.

Virtualmin GPL is the core web control panel software with a solid feature set and a pleasant user interface. This product is also available in Webmin module form. Virtualmin offers four methods for managing your server: from the Web, mobile, command line, and through a remote HTTP API.
